Failed findings

  • Food In Original Container, Properly Labeled: Customer Advisory Posted As Needed
    Inspector note: ALL COOKED POTENTIALLY HAZARDOUS FOODS INSIDE THE WALK IN COOLER MUST HAVE A DATE AND LABEL(NAME OF THE PRODUCT).
    code 30
  • Floors: Constructed Per Code, Cleaned, Good Repair, Coving Installed, Dust-Less Cleaning Methods Used
    Inspector note: BROKEN FLOOR TILES IN THE DISH WASHING AREA . MUST REPAIR AND MAINTAIN.
    code 34
  • Walls, Ceilings, Attached Equipment Constructed Per Code: Good Repair, Surfaces Clean And Dust-Less Cleaning Methods
    Inspector note: DAMAGED CEILING TILES ABOVE THE DISPLAY COOLER WITH MEAT. MUST REPLACE AND MAINTAIN. WALLS BY THE KITCHEN/PREP AREA, BEHIND THE PREP TABLES. FILTER ON THE HOOD WITH GREASE BUILD UP. MUST CLEAN, REMOVE GREASE AND MAINTAIN.
    code 35
  • grimy wiping cloths
    Official wording: Premises Maintained Free Of Litter, Unnecessary Articles, Cleaning Equipment Properly Stored
    Inspector note: CLUTTER IN THE BASEMENT. INSTRUCTED TO ELEVATE ALL ITEMS/ARTICLES OFF THE FLOOR TO PREVENT RODENT/INSECTS HARBORAGE. FOUND CLEANING EQUIPMENTS(BROOMS,DUST PANS) STORED ON THE PREP AREA BY THE PREP TABLES. INSTRUCTED TO STORE ALL CLEANING EQUIPMENTS BY THE MOP SINK AREA.
    code 41
  • Food (Ice) Dispensing Utensils, Wash Cloths Properly Stored
    Inspector note: ALL WASH CLOTH FOR WIPING THE PREP TABLES, COOLERS,CHOPPING BOARDS MUST BE STORED ON A BUCKET WITH SANITIZING SOLUTION.
    code 43
  • Food Handler Requirements Met
    Inspector note: NO FOOD HANDLERS CERTIFICATE FOR THE OTHER 3 EMPLOYEES. MUST PROVIDE.
    code 45
